💡 The Master Resume Philosophy

There's no such thing as 'one perfect resume.' Every job requires different emphasis, different keywords, and different content selection.

Most resume services give you ONE static document. Then what? You're stuck using the same resume for every application (which doesn't work) or you don't know how to adapt it.

This service teaches you the SYSTEM:

Step 1: Build your Master Resume Bullet Document—a comprehensive database of ALL your experiences, accomplishments, and skills.

Step 2: Learn to TAILOR by pulling relevant content for each specific job application.

Step 3: Use professional templates to quickly create customized versions.
